termites are insects that live in colonies. in a colony, the king and a queen are responsible for reproduction. workers spend most of their time caring for the other termites and building the nest. soldiers protect the nest from attacks. the organization of the termite colony is an example of which benefit of social behavior? foraging protection reproduction division of labor
Answer
Answer:
D. division of labor
Brief Explanation:
In the termite colony, different roles (king - queen for reproduction, workers for caring and building, soldiers for protection) show division of labor.
